Title: From graphic literacy across languages to integrating English and content teaching in vocational settings
Authors: Tang, Gloria M.
Issue Date: 1997
Journal: Hong Kong Journal of Applied Linguistics
Abstract: Focuses on the use of various graphic structures in the teaching of both English and other content vocational subjects in Hong Kong. Concludes that many of the knowledge structures are common to the two situations, and makes suggestions for maximizing learning in these situations. (Author/VWL)
